72-Hour Auto-Cancellation

Recommended for: Traveler, NDEA, Travel Clerk, AO, RO | Series: DTS (Basics)

This information paper provides an overview of the 72-hour auto-cancellation rule and how it applies in DTS. It explains the cancellation policy and why the airline reservation is automatically cancelled by the carrier to avoid unfilled seats.

Cancellation Procedures

Recommended for: Travel Clerk, NDEA, RO, AO, Traveler, LDTA, ODTA | Series: DTS (Special Topics)

 

This web-based training demonstrates how to cancel trips in the DTS, whether expenses were incurred for the trip or not. It outlines the correct cancellation procedures to guarantee that correct reimbursements are made, ensuring that neither the traveler nor the government incur any additional expenses after the cancellation.

Constructed Travel

Recommended for: AO, Travel Clerk, NDEA, RO, Traveler | Series: DTS (Special Topics)


This web-based training explains correct way to submit a Constructed travel request for TDY travel, for approval to use a transportation mode other than the one directed by the Authorizing Official. The class walks through the process of preparing a cost comparison using a Pre-Travel and Post-Travel Worksheets, and how using constructed travel may affect trip allowances.

OCONUS Travel

Recommended for: AO, RO, Traveler, Travel Clerk, NDEA | Series: DTS (Special Topics)

 

This web-based class covers how to use DTS to arrange travel and claim expenses for OCONUS trips. It explains the process for making OCONUS travel reservations, the impact to per diem allowances when crossing the International Date Line, and the process of claiming OCONUS reimbursable expenses on a DTS voucher.

Reports

Recommended for: DMM, FDTA, ODTA, LDTA, BDTA, CBA-S | Series: DTS (Admin), DTS (Special Topics)

 

This web-based class explains how to produce DTS travel related reports. DoD travel managers (such as Defense Travel Administrators [DTAs]) use the reports to gather real-time data to manage their organization's travel program. From individual trip itineraries and lodging details to budgets and routing lists, DTS reports provide data on nearly every facet of official travel, thereby improving oversight of travel and its associated administrative processes.
